Periodic Defragmentation in Elastic Optical Networks

Abstract

The main weakness of Elastic Optical Networks (EON) stems from spectrum fragmentation. An analysis of periodic defragmentation in EONs under dynamic traffic conditions is carried out. The effects of different defragmentation parameters on the EON performance are evaluated, and appropriate values, guaranteeing suitable network performance while keeping the network control complexity at a reasonable point, are obtained through simulations. Different network topologies as well as traffic conditions are simulated to assess the validity of the obtained results.
